Which LinkedIn pages work

Stay signed in to LinkedIn, open one of the pages below, then click the Reachly icon.

  • Home feed — Reachly lists visible posts for comment, DM, and email drafts.
  • A single post (/posts/…) — the same post actions, focused on that thread.
  • A member profile (/in/…) — profile outreach (connect note, DM, email) plus any activity posts that are on screen.

LinkedIn Jobs (search, collections, or /jobs/view) opens Job details instead of Posts outreach. Analyse the role there. Selection does not take over on job URLs.

Outreach from a profile

  1. 1Open someone’s LinkedIn profile and wait until the page finishes loading.
  2. 2Open Reachly. You should see Profile outreach and their name, headline, and contact details when LinkedIn shows them.
  3. 3Pick a purpose chip (Networking, Job opportunity, Hiring, Freelance / contract, and so on).
  4. 4Generate, then switch between Connect Note, Send DM, and Send Email.
  5. 5Copy the draft and paste it into LinkedIn’s connect, messaging, or your mail client. Use Revise if you want a tighter or more specific version.

If the profile looks empty, make sure it finished loading, then tap Refresh in the popup. After an extension update, reload the LinkedIn tab first.

Outreach from the feed

  1. 1Open the LinkedIn home feed (or a post permalink) and scroll so posts are actually visible.
  2. 2Open Reachly. Posts outreach lists the posts it can read.
  3. 3Optional: tap Classify intents. Aastha labels each post (hiring, freelance, networking, and similar) so you can filter the list. Classification uses one AI credit.
  4. 4Expand a post, choose Comment, Send DM, or Send Email, pick a purpose, then Generate.
  5. 5Copy the draft into LinkedIn. Comments lead with a useful take on the post; DMs and emails stay specific to the person and the purpose you chose.

If you see “No posts found”, scroll the feed, then tap Refresh posts. Do not stay on notifications, messaging, or company admin pages — those are unsupported.

Purposes

Purpose chips steer tone and ask. Changing purpose clears the current draft so the next generate matches the new intent.

  • Networking, Job opportunity, Hiring, Freelance / contract
  • Collaboration, Mentorship, Partnership, Follow-up
